Дельфи

-=Mafia=-
8/6/2006, 2:39:42 AM
Подскажите пожалуйста. Нужно чтобы написав например цену 10 рублей, по нажатию кнопки получалось "десять рублей"
Модест
8/7/2006, 5:59:03 PM
procedure TForm1.Button1Click(Sender: TObject);
begin
ShowMessage('Десять рублей')
end;
-=Велла=-
8/7/2006, 6:05:37 PM
а если там будет любая цифра, тогда что? писать миллион процедур на миллион цифр? а если с копейками?
Модест
8/8/2006, 1:58:17 PM
Мой телепатор в ремонте. Какой вопрос, такой и ответ :)
mvf23
8/12/2006, 6:29:31 AM
Специально для тех кто ещё не понял в чем вопрос.

Требуется преобразовать число в пропись на Delphi.

Вопрос изначально поставлен конечно не очень корректно, но достаточно понятно.
mvf23
8/12/2006, 3:30:14 PM
ИМХО задача для школьника. Примерно 20-30 строчек кода если без сопряжения окончаний. Максимум 100 - если с сопряжением. Валяется повсеместно... Могу написать с нуля за 15-20 мин. почти на любом языке программирования.

Поиск в гугле

Вот прямые ссылки на странички с исходниками

https://subscribe.ru/archive/comp.soft.prog...1/04221229.html
https://www.delphikingdom.com/asp/itemq.asp?mode=1&ItemID=431
https://www.delphikingdom.com/asp/viewitem.asp?catalogid=17
https://www.delphikingdom.com/asp/viewitem.asp?catalogid=805
https://www.delphikingdom.com/asp/viewitem.asp?catalogid=1105
https://www.delphikingdom.com/asp/viewitem.asp?catalogid=1106

А вот обратная задача - из прописи в число несколько сложнее. Особенно с учетом разных падежей. Вот такое в интернете не найдешь. Уже давным-давно писал для знакомой как раз на Delphi (ещё на третьем) калькулятор на русском языке (ей это нужно было в качестве курсовика). Типа "сумма двух и трех умноженная на пять" ну и ответ 25. :) Если кому надо - могу попробовать откопать исходники.
RoyalFlesh
8/15/2006, 10:33:42 AM
Мнда, из-за такого пустяка начинать новую тему (возглас удивления и непонимания)...
Saturas
11/11/2006, 2:44:28 AM
(RoyalFlesh @ 15.08.2006 - время: 06:33) Мнда, из-за такого пустяка начинать новую тему (возглас удивления и непонимания)...
Полностью согласен с высказыванием.
По-моему легче такую ерунду самому сесть и написать.
Чем потратить кучу времени на написание темы в форуме, на ожидание ответов.
Да потом, в своем коде в любом случае легче разбираться.
kiskus
11/17/2006, 11:44:03 AM
Вот программа и исходники на Delphi7.
При вводе числа и нажатии перевод выдает число прописью.
Работает от 1 до 1000.
Ну а рубли, копейки и больший разряд я думаю, что по аналогии сделать
не трудно.